In this photograph, taken by renowned explorer and photographer Frank Hurley during the Imperial Trans-Antarctic Expedition (1914-17), led by Sir Ernest Shackleton, Tom Crean, an Irish seaman and veteran of several Antarctic expeditions, cradles four adorable puppies in his arms. The image, held at the Scott Polar Research Institute, University of Cambridge, offers a rare moment of respite and warmth amidst the harsh, icy terrain of the frozen continent. Tom Crean, a man of indomitable spirit and unyielding determination, had already proven himself in the harshest of conditions. He had served under Shackleton during the Nimrod Expedition (1907-09), during which they reached the farthest point south on record at that time. Crean's bravery and endurance were once again put to the test during the Endurance Expedition, where he played a crucial role in the survival of the crew after their ship was trapped in pack ice and eventually sank.
